Understanding Stress and Mental Clarity

What Is Stress?

Stress is the body’s natural response to challenges or demands. While short-term stress can be helpful, chronic stress can negatively affect both mental and physical health.

What Is Mental Clarity?

Mental clarity refers to a state of clear thinking, focus, and awareness. It allows you to make better decisions and stay productive.

The Connection Between the Two

High stress levels can cloud your thinking, reduce concentration, and lead to mental fatigue. Reducing stress is essential for achieving better mental clarity.

Easy Ways to Reduce Stress

1. Practice Deep Breathing

Deep breathing is one of the simplest ways to calm your mind.

How to do it:

  • Inhale slowly through your nose
  • Hold for a few seconds
  • Exhale through your mouth

This helps reduce anxiety and promotes relaxation.


2. Stay Physically Active

Exercise is a powerful stress reliever.

Benefits:

  • Releases endorphins
  • Improves mood
  • Reduces tension

Even a 20–30 minute walk can make a difference.


3. Maintain a Healthy Sleep Routine

Lack of sleep increases stress and reduces mental clarity.

Tips:

  • Sleep 7–8 hours daily
  • Maintain a consistent schedule
  • Avoid screens before bedtime

4. Practice Mindfulness and Meditation

Mindfulness helps you stay present and reduces overthinking.

Simple Practice:

  • Sit quietly
  • Focus on your breath
  • Observe your thoughts without judgment

5. Limit Screen Time

Excessive use of smartphones and social media can increase stress.

Solutions:

  • Set screen time limits
  • Take regular breaks
  • Avoid devices before bed

6. Stay Organized

Clutter and disorganization can lead to stress.

Tips:

  • Create a daily to-do list
  • Prioritize tasks
  • Keep your workspace clean

7. Eat a Balanced Diet

Nutrition plays a key role in mental health.

Include:

  • Fruits and vegetables
  • Whole grains
  • Lean proteins

Avoid excessive caffeine and sugar.


8. Take Regular Breaks

Working continuously can lead to burnout.

Try:

  • The Pomodoro technique
  • Short breaks every hour

9. Connect with Others

Talking to friends or family can reduce stress.

Benefits:

  • Emotional support
  • Better mood
  • Reduced loneliness

10. Engage in Hobbies

Doing something you enjoy can help you relax.

Examples:

  • Reading
  • Painting
  • Gardening

Ways to Improve Mental Clarity

1. Start Your Day with a Clear Plan

Planning your day helps you stay focused and organized.


2. Practice Journaling

Writing down your thoughts can clear your mind.


3. Stay Hydrated

Dehydration can affect brain function and concentration.


4. Reduce Multitasking

Focus on one task at a time for better efficiency.


5. Declutter Your Environment

A clean space promotes clear thinking.


6. Practice Gratitude

Focusing on positive aspects of life improves mental clarity.


7. Limit Negative Inputs

Avoid excessive exposure to negative news or content.
